That was pretty good Dale!! That is a Swiss flag flying so we know their nationality. The Swiss have four official languages though, hard to tell which they are singing in. Swiss German, French, Italian, and Romansch are their official languages. Amore is Italian for love, but the rest does not sound like Italian to me. I'm thinking either Swiss German or Romansch. Swiss German is the dominant language and most widely used.
